**What are the pros and cons of a reclining sofa for your living room?**

**Pros:**
1. Comfort: Reclining sofas offer added comfort and relaxation in the living room.
2. Versatility: They come in various styles and sizes to match any home decor interior design.
3. Space-saving: Reclining sofas can save space by eliminating the need for a separate ottoman or footrest.
4. Health benefits: They can help improve posture and reduce the risk of back pain.

**Cons:**
1. Maintenance: Regular cleaning and upkeep are required to keep the sofa in good condition.
2. Cost: Higher quality reclining sofas can be pricey compared to traditional sofas.
3. Limited placement options: Reclining sofas require adequate space to fully recline.

For optimal interior planning and design, consider the layout of your living room before purchasing a reclining sofa. Make sure to measure the space to ensure the sofa fits appropriately. Additionally, choose a color that complements your existing home decor and consider the material for durability.

Pros of a Reclining Sofa:

A reclining sofa can bring a touch of luxury and comfort to your living room. It offers several benefits that can enhance your relaxation and overall living room experience.

Comfort:

One of the most significant advantages of a reclining sofa is the comfort it provides. With the ability to recline and adjust the backrest and footrest to your desired position, you can find the perfect angle for relaxation. Whether you want to sit upright, recline slightly, or fully stretch out, a reclining sofa offers versatile comfort options.

Space-saving:

Unlike traditional sofas that require additional space for a separate ottoman or footrest, a reclining sofa combines seating and leg support in one piece of furniture. This space-saving design is particularly beneficial for smaller living rooms or apartments where maximizing space is essential.

Customizable Comfort:

Many reclining sofas come with built-in features such as adjustable headrests, lumbar support, and power reclining options. These customizable comfort settings allow you to tailor your seating experience to your preferences. Whether you need extra neck support or want to recline with the push of a button, a reclining sofa offers personalized comfort.

Cons of a Reclining Sofa:

While a reclining sofa offers various advantages, there are some drawbacks to consider before making a purchase.

Space Requirements:

Reclining sofas typically require more space than traditional sofas, especially when fully reclined. Before purchasing a reclining sofa, measure your living room to ensure there is enough clearance for the sofa to recline comfortably without obstructing walkways or other furniture.

Maintenance:

Reclining sofas with mechanical parts such as motors or levers may require more maintenance than standard sofas. Regularly check and lubricate the reclining mechanisms to ensure smooth operation and prevent malfunctions. Additionally, consider the warranty and repair options when purchasing a reclining sofa to address any potential issues that may arise.

Conclusion:

In conclusion, a reclining sofa offers several benefits such as comfort, space-saving design, and customizable comfort settings. However, it is essential to consider the space requirements and maintenance needs of a reclining sofa before making a purchase. By weighing the pros and cons, you can determine if a reclining sofa is the right choice for your living room.

1. What are the benefits of having a reclining sofa in your living room?
A reclining sofa offers ultimate comfort and relaxation, allowing you to easily adjust the position to your liking. It provides excellent lumbar support, reducing back pain and promoting better posture. The reclining feature is perfect for lounging, watching TV, or taking a nap. Some reclining sofas come with additional features like built-in USB ports and cup holders for added convenience. They are often made with high-quality materials for durability and longevity.

2. Are there any drawbacks to having a reclining sofa?
One potential drawback of a reclining sofa is that it takes up more space compared to a regular sofa, so you need to ensure you have enough room in your living room. The mechanical parts of a reclining sofa may require maintenance over time, and they can be more expensive than traditional sofas. Additionally, if not properly maintained, the reclining mechanism may break or become less smooth over time.

3. How do I choose the right reclining sofa for my living room?
When selecting a reclining sofa, consider the size of your living room, the style of the sofa, the material used, and any additional features. It’s essential to test the reclining mechanism to ensure it operates smoothly and effortlessly. Look for reputable brands known for their quality craftsmanship and customer service. Consider the warranty and return policy when making your purchase.

4. Can a reclining sofa improve my overall well-being?
Yes, a reclining sofa can improve your overall well-being by providing proper support for your back and neck, reducing muscle tension, and promoting relaxation. It can help alleviate stress and anxiety, allowing you to unwind after a long day. By enabling you to adjust the position to your comfort level, a reclining sofa can enhance your quality of life and contribute to better physical and mental health.

5. What are some tips for maintaining a reclining sofa?
To keep your reclining sofa in good condition, regularly clean and vacuum the upholstery to remove dirt and debris. Foll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for cleaning and maintenance to prevent damage. Avoid placing heavy objects on the footrest or using excessive force when reclining. If you notice any issues with the reclining mechanism, contact the manufacturer or a professional for repairs. Consider using a furniture protector to extend the lifespan of your reclining sofa.
